在本文中,我们将深入探讨 **MongoDB fields元数据** 的问题,围绕其背景定位、核心维度、特性拆解、实战对比、深度原理和选型指南进行全面的分析和讨论。 ### 背景定位 MongoDB作为一种高效、可扩展的NoSQL数据库,在处理大量动态数据时表现出色。随着字段元数据对数据管理和查询效率的影响逐渐显现,如何有效管理和利用这些元数据成为了一项重要任务。 ```mermaid qua
原创 7月前
28阅读
# 查看MongoDBFields ## 简介 在MongoDB中,每个文档都可以具有不同的字段,以存储不同的数据。如果想要查看某个集合中的字段,可以通过一系列的步骤来实现。本文将详细介绍这个过程,并提供相应的代码示例。 ## 流程 下面是查看MongoDB字段的整个流程: ```mermaid sequenceDiagram participant User part
原创 2023-10-11 09:56:41
24阅读
MongoDB聚合运算符:$reduce 文章目录MongoDB聚合运算符:$reduce语法字段说明例1例2例3举例乘法概率步骤商品折扣字符串连接数组合并单次折叠多次折叠 $reduce聚合运算符将一个表达式应用于数组的每个元素并将它们合并为一个值。 语法{ $reduce: { input: <array>, initialValue: &l
转载 2024-10-09 22:17:31
36阅读
1,去官网下载安装包点击进入官网下载2,使用xshell连接上阿里云 没有xshell和xftp的先到官网下载安装,点击进入官网下载 先创建好等下用来放MongoDB的文件夹(目录)cd / mkdir ./software cd software mkdir ./mongodb3,使用xftp将刚刚下载的安装包拖到刚刚创建的这个文件夹下面4,回到xshell窗口,使用命令解压安装包tar -xz
转载 2023-11-07 17:59:36
57阅读
Mongodb权威指南笔笔记整理-文档操作一、插入并保存文档     插入是想MongoDB中添加数据的基本方法,对目标集使用insert方法,插入一个文档: 1. > db.person.insert({name:"joe",age:24}) 2. WriteResult({ "nInserted" : 1 }) 这个操作会给文档增加一个"_id
转载 2024-03-12 14:18:23
52阅读
上一讲生成了mongodb服务,这里可以手动启动方式;windows+R    ->     services.msc     ->   找到mongodb并启动或者以管理员身份启动cmd,输入net start mongodb然后可以在cmd中输入mongodb的命令了。 首
转载 2023-08-29 19:13:28
0阅读
一、1、下载好http://www.mongodb.org/downloads 的包,放到指定的盘符,我放在C盘mongo的文件夹里  2、打开cmd,首先找到“mongodb”的路径,然后运行mongod开启命令,同时用--dbpath指定数据存放地点为“db”文件夹 注意:这是网上的截图 我的是c盘 mongo文件夹;就运行起来了3、要看下是否开启成功,mongodb采用27017端
转载 2023-08-01 11:09:46
345阅读
1评论
# MongoDB中的$out操作符 在MongoDB中,$out操作符用于将查询结果存储到一个新的集合中。它是MongoDB的聚合管道操作符之一,可以在聚合操作中使用。 ## $out操作的作用 $out操作的主要作用是将聚合管道的结果保存到一个新的集合中。它可以用于创建新的集合,或者覆盖已存在的集合。当我们需要对聚合操作的结果进行持久化存储时,$out操作非常有用。 ## 使用$out
原创 2023-08-01 21:31:21
162阅读
目录一、方法定义二、IP绑定三、方法特点四、使用示例1.向新副本集中添加辅助节点2.向现有副本集中添加辅助节点3.向副本集中添加优先级为0的成员4.向副本集中添加仲裁节点 一、方法定义rs.add(host, arbiterOnly)方法作用:将成员添加到副本集。要使用此方法,必须连接到副本集的主节点上。参数说明:参数名类型说明 host string 或 
转载 2023-08-28 13:21:55
101阅读
1.MongoDB官网下载对应的版本 选择自己要下载的版本2.开始安装 一路next下去,最后的 Install MongoDB Compass不要勾选,不然要安装好久。一定要记住!!!3.默认路径安装好之后,在C盘中 一直找到MongoDB安装路径下的bin目录 将该目录复制C:\Program Files\MongoDB\Server\4.2\bin4.配置环境变量 选择高级系统设置 -&gt
转载 2023-10-29 22:32:32
120阅读
mongodb基本操作,常用增删改查1.显式创建集合db.createCollection(“users”)db.createCollection("users") { ok: 1 } rs0 [direct: primary]2.隐式创建集合db.users1.insert({name:“23123”})db.users1.insert({name:"23123"}) 'DeprecationW
转载 2024-03-04 14:37:53
40阅读
上篇讲了MongoDB的基础知识,大家应该对MongoDB有所了解了,当然真正用的还是curd操作,本篇为大家讲解MongoDB的curd操作。 1、数据库操作  #1、增 use config #如果数据库不存在,则创建数据库,否则切换到指定数据库。 #2、查 show dbs #查看所有 要想显示出刚创建的数据库,我们需要向数据库插入一些数据。 db.table1.in
转载 2023-10-11 14:58:04
192阅读
Kettle转换控件转换属于ETL的T,T就是Transform清洗、转换。ETL三个部分中,T花费时间最长,是“一般情况下这部分工作量是整个ETL的2/3。Concat fields (连接字段)Concat fields就是多个字段连接起来形成一个新的字段。值映射值映射就是把字段的一个值映射成其他的值。 在数据质量规范上使用非常多,比如很多系统对应性别gender字段的定义不同。 系统1:1
转载 2024-09-13 06:16:09
70阅读
Mongodb默认启动是不带认证,也没有账号,只要能连接上服务就可以对数据库进行各种操作,这样可不行。现在,我们得一步步开启使用用户和认证。 第一步,我们得定位到mongodb的安装目录。我本机的是C:\mongodb。 然后按着shift键右键点击窗口内的空白处,你会看到有个选项 “在此处打开...
原创 2021-12-30 14:00:26
77阅读
修改oplog有四种方法:方法一步骤如下:停掉所有secondary节点主节点删除local目录下文件,副本节点删除数据目录下所有文件修改所有节点的配置文件,如:oplogSize=1000重启所有节点,包括主节点和副本节点重新配置replca set,副本节点会重新同步数据(initial sync)优点:操作简单。缺点:需要停服务,若数据量大,数据同步代价高。方法二步骤如下:remove其中一
转载 1月前
386阅读
使用SharePoint对象模型可以完成页面上所有与列表字段相关的操作,向列表添加字段可以使用SPList对象的Fields.Add()方法来实现,此方法有3个重载参数,可以根据不同的参数条件创建字段。Fields.Add()方法的重载参数如下: public string Add(SPField field); public string Add(string strDi
转载 精选 2012-08-17 11:33:06
629阅读
1点赞
首先,我要强调的是,Python中没有getClass().getFields(),因为一个对象可以有很多未由类定义的字段。实际上,要在Python中创建一个字段,只需为其指定一个值。这些字段不是定义的,而是创建的:>>> class Foo(object):... def __init__(self, value): ... # The __init__ method will
## MongoDB添加用户权限错误解决方法 ### 一、问题描述 在使用MongoDB时,有时会遇到如下错误提示:`mongodb couldn't add user: not authorized on`。这个错误提示意味着用户没有足够的权限来执行添加用户的操作。下面我将为你详细介绍如何解决这个问题。 ### 二、解决流程 #### 1. 创建管理员用户 首先,我们需要创建一个具有管理
原创 2023-09-08 07:47:32
992阅读
$myId = 5;$result = db_select('table', 't')->fields('t')->condition('id', $myId, '=')->execute()->fetchAssoc();?>the above is equivelent to:SELECT t.*...
转载 2015-05-04 18:11:00
102阅读
2评论
接上篇,这里主要介绍利用Mongodb的cli对集合中的记录进行增删改查的操作,简单地说,就是Record级别上进行的操作。从这里开始,我们用事先存在的(上)中提到的blogtest数据库做测试,其中有两个Collection,一个是book,另一个是user。1 插入操作1.1 向user集合中插入两条记录 > db.user.insert({'name':'Gal Gadot','gen
转载 2023-10-28 07:26:10
85阅读
  • 1
  • 2
  • 3
  • 4
  • 5